4 THORNSCROFT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the Horsham local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 4 THORNSCROFT sales between June 2003 and January 2024 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the June 2017 sale was for 2%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 2% below the HPI over time, until the January 2024 sale, where it rises to 11%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 11% above the HPI.

What might 4 THORNSCROFT be worth now?

4 THORNSCROFT might now be worth an estimated £410,577.

This is based on house price inflation of 8%, between January 2024 and July 2025, for terraced houses, in the Horsham local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 8%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 4 THORNSCROFT of £380,000 on 30th January 2024. For the value to have increased from £380,000 to £410,577 over the six months to July 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 4 THORNSCROFT has moved in line with the HPI for terraced houses in the Horsham local authority area.
  • The January 2024 sale price of £380,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 4 THORNSCROFT has not materially changed since January 2024.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.
